How We Picked the Best PoE Security Camera Systems with AI Detection

We prioritized systems that combine wired PoE reliability with AI-assisted motion filtering, since that combination helps reduce false alerts and improves day-to-day usability. We also looked for practical ownership features like included NVR storage, multi-camera support, night vision performance, local recording, and outdoor-ready camera construction.

For buyers comparing PoE Security Camera Systems with AI Detection, the most important question is not just resolution, but whether the system is sized correctly for the property and offers useful detection modes such as person, vehicle, and pet recognition.

Quick Comparison

For small homes, 4-camera kits are often the simplest and most affordable fit. Mid-size properties usually benefit from 6 to 8 cameras and an 8-channel NVR. Larger homes, multi-building properties, and businesses should look at 12- or 16-channel systems with higher-capacity storage and room to expand.

Resolution also matters, but more megapixels are only helpful when the rest of the system is balanced. A 4K or 12MP kit is ideal if you want sharper license plate, face, or driveway detail. If you mainly want dependable perimeter coverage, a good 5MP system may be enough.

Key Buying Factors for PoE Security Camera Systems with AI Detection

Detection Accuracy

Look for AI that can distinguish people and vehicles from routine motion like trees, shadows, or rain. Better classification usually means fewer nuisance alerts and faster reactions to real events.

Camera Type and Field of View

Bullet cameras often work well for long driveways and perimeter lines, while domes are usually better for sheltered entries and tamper resistance. Wide-angle and dual-lens models can cover more area, but check for distortion and whether detail remains sharp at the edges.

Storage and Recording

Included hard drives are a major plus. If you want longer retention or multiple cameras recording 24/7, choose an NVR with enough bays or a larger installed drive. Local recording is also useful if you want to avoid subscription fees.

Durability and Installation

Outdoor ratings such as IP67 and vandal-resistant housings matter in exposed locations. Also consider cable runs, power needs, and whether the system includes enough camera channels for future expansion.
